Mississippi Valley State University is located in Itta Bena, Mississippi and approximately 2,032 students attend the school each year. In 2021, 26 liberal arts majors received their bachelor's degree from Mississippi Valley State University.

During the 2020-2021 academic year, 26 liberal arts majors earned their bachelor's degree from Mississippi Valley State University. Of these graduates, 35% were men and 65% were women.

undefined

Prospective students may be interested in knowing that this school graduates 52% more racial-ethnic minorities in its liberal arts bachelor's program than the national average.*
